Crimson Star
Variety of Goji berry · Lycium barbarum
Very productive, compact cultivar with large, sweet-tart berries and strong cold hardiness.

Description
Fruit
Large, bright-red berries with a tangy-sweet taste and few seeds.
Growth
Medium shrub, usually 2–2.5 m; more compact than the Lifeberry types.
Yield
Bears 1–2 years after planting; among the most productive western cultivars.
Notes
Self-fertile; cold-hardy to about -20 °C.
